Dues
This is a contribution
from each girl that stays with the troop. It is usually collected on a
weekly basis to help teach girls responsibility and money management. The
range of dues is often 25 cents to $1.00 weekly. However, the amount may
be determined by the girls and Girl Scout leader based on their plans and
family situations. Opportunity Funds are available for assistance.
The troop dues amount
must be fair and affordable for all girls. Give parents the opportunity to
express any concerns about the dues amount at a "Parents' Meeting".
Leaders should make certain that each girl and her family understands that
troop dues are collected for each meeting. Since dues cover troop
expenses, girls missing a meeting should pay dues for that meeting at
another meeting.

Dues Collecting Idea: Use a coffee
can - decorated if you wish. Have one clothes pin per girl.
Write girls' names on the clothespins. Attach the pins to the rim of
the coffee can. When girls arrive, they take their clothes pin and
clip their dues to it. Drop it in the bucket!
